Setting Up Your Mobile 5G Home Internet
Setting up your mobile 5G Wi-Fi home internet can be a smooth process if you follow these steps carefully. Here’s a simple guide to help you get started.
Step 1: Unbox and Power On the Gateway
Begin by unboxing your 5G gateway. Inside the box, you’ll find the gateway modem/router combo, a power adapter, and a quick start guide.
To power on the gateway, plug the power cable into the back of the device and connect the other end to a wall outlet. The gateway should turn on automatically. Wait for it to fully boot up before proceeding.
Step 2: Download the T-Mobile Internet App
Next, you will need to download the T-Mobile Internet app. This is available on both the iOS App Store and the Google Play Store for Android devices.
After downloading, open the app and log in using your T-Mobile ID. If you don’t have an account, be sure to create one during the setup process.
Step 3: Find the Best Location for Your Gateway
Once you have the app up and running, it’s essential to find the best location for your gateway. Use the app to identify the spot in your home with the strongest 5G signal.
For optimal performance, place the gateway near a window, ideally on a higher floor, and keep it away from walls and other obstructions.
Step 4: Connect to the Wi-Fi Network
Your gateway will broadcast two Wi-Fi networks: a 2.4 GHz network for longer range and a 5 GHz network for shorter range but faster speeds.
Locate the Wi-Fi network names and passwords. This information is usually printed on a label on your gateway. Use the app to connect your devices to the desired network.
